MG Windsor Pro Set to Launch Tomorrow with Larger 52.9kWh Battery

MG Windsor Pro Set to Launch Tomorrow

MG Motor is gearing up to unveil the Windsor Pro, an upgraded version of its popular electric vehicle, tomorrow. Positioned above the standard Windsor, the new Pro variant brings a larger 52.9kWh battery, added tech features, and refreshed styling inside and out.

Key Highlights:

Bigger Battery, Longer Range

While the Windsor Pro retains the same 136hp and 200Nm front-wheel-drive powertrain as the current model, the jump from the existing 38kWh battery to 52.9kWh is expected to significantly boost its driving range. The current Windsor has an ARAI-claimed range of 332km, with real-world testing showing about 308km at an impressive efficiency of 8.1km/kWh. In comparison, the Tata Nexon EV, with a 45kWh battery, delivers around 350km but at slightly lower efficiency.

With the upgraded battery, the Windsor Pro could realistically achieve up to 400km in everyday driving conditions, making it more suitable for intercity travel.

Faster Charging, More Versatility

Charging performance is another strong point. In previous tests, the Windsor managed to recover 232km of range in just 35 minutes using a DC fast charger. With V2L and V2V capabilities now on board, the Pro variant also gains flexibility in powering external devices or even charging other EVs.

Feature Additions and Styling Tweaks

The Windsor Pro gets more than just a mechanical update. It introduces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) for added safety and convenience, and rolls out with a refreshed look including new alloy wheels and updated cabin materials. The interior now features a dual-tone black and beige leatherette trim, replacing the all-black finish of the standard Windsor.

Sales Success and Pricing Outlook

Since its debut in September 2024, the MG Windsor has quickly made its mark in India’s EV space. Over 19,000 units were sold by March 2025—averaging 2,700+ units per month—outpacing even the long-reigning Tata Nexon EV.

With the introduction of the Windsor Pro and its larger battery, MG is poised to further strengthen its hold on the EV market. While pricing is expected to rise above the current ₹14–16 lakh range, the added range and features could make it a compelling upgrade for EV buyers.
